Martin Woods is a 40-year-old football player who plays as a defensive midfielder, born on 1 janvier 1986, who is both-footed. Follow Martin Woods on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.
In the 2024/2025 National League season, Martin Woods has recorded 0 goals, 0 assists, 749 minutes, 2 yellow cards.

Martin Woods's career has included time at Worksop Town, Boston United, Brackley Town, FC Halifax Town, Dundee FC, Partick Thistle, Ross County, Shrewsbury Town, Barnsley, Doncaster Rovers, Yeovil Town, Rotherham United, Sunderland, and Leeds United as a player and Boston United as a coach.

Throughout their career, Martin Woods has won 2 titles: League Cup (2015/2016) with Ross County and League One (2012/2013) with Doncaster Rovers.
